Check Point research announces first documented case of AI-evading malware

The discovery, announced by Check Point Research, reveals a new category of cyberthreat designed to bypass AI-powered security systems. This is the first documented case of AI-evading malware that uses natural language text to manipulate defense tools.

The malware was designed to be classified as safe by large-scale language models (LLMs). This incident, despite its failure, marks the beginning of a new front in cybersecurity focused on exploiting AI tools themselves.

Analysis of the file, uploaded anonymously to the VirusTotal platform, revealed a string of text that sought to trick an AI model. The instruction, written in C++, asked the system to ignore previous commands and respond with the message “NO MALWARE DETECTED”.

While it also contains traditional tactics, such as TOR network components and sandbox evasion, the focus on AI manipulation is what sets this threat apart. Check Point’s detection system was able to identify both the malicious nature of the file and the prompt injection manipulation attempt, successfully neutralizing the attack.

AI-Evading Malware: A New Phase in the Evolution of Cyberattacks...The emergence of AI-evading malware marks a new race between attackers and defenders, similar to the one that occurred with the emergence of techniques to avoid detection in sandbox environments. As companies integrate artificial intelligence into their defenses, attackers are beginning to develop methods to exploit its weaknesses.

This development confirms that cybercriminals are not only adapting to new protection technologies, but are also actively studying them to turn them into attack vectors. The strategy is no longer just hiding the malware, but also actively deceiving the intelligence that is looking for it.

In short, the identification of this AI-evasion malware serves as a wake-up call for the industry. Even if its first attempt failed, its intent to manipulate AI systems has been proven. This event foreshadows a future where digital threats will become increasingly sophisticated, requiring AI-based security tools to constantly evolve to protect themselves.
